Output 267fc079af60b466cb4c6477de612e53ba09c7e4dafe47604c836afc02fd8fda:202

value
58914
script pubkey
OP_0 OP_PUSHBYTES_32 c6ab938530dff8d33a279a9a9af3e12b572819cf4df6635b7345f2fba77e23a6
address
bc1qc64e8pfsmludxw38n2df4ulp9dtjsxw0fhmxxkmnghe0hfm7ywnq0lr2es
transaction
267fc079af60b466cb4c6477de612e53ba09c7e4dafe47604c836afc02fd8fda
confirmations
99590
spent
true